Transaction faefdb902428615f3bc548144b6a67ee60b57a8a2e73170e8274caf4ccfa1224

1 Input
2 Outputs
  • faefdb902428615f3bc548144b6a67ee60b57a8a2e73170e8274caf4ccfa1224:0
  • value  1995804
    address  1EMCxtxZqKr8215tXVpajbxTqLcNis3Qyv
  • faefdb902428615f3bc548144b6a67ee60b57a8a2e73170e8274caf4ccfa1224:1
  • value  27963256
    address  1EidtcjG6Z42ZBTz9w8yDSYyhFCtjQ3bUY